At Jeff’s Bagel Run, we specialize in New York-style bagels made with the finest, high-quality ingredients and traditional small-batch baking techniques. Located in Houston, TX, we offer a wide selection of freshly baked, hand-crafted bagels, unique cream cheeses, lattes, freshly brewed coffees, and cold brew. Whether you’re craving a delicious breakfast for yourself or need catering for your next event, we have the perfect options to satisfy your cravings. We have been looking for a bagel place for years traveling from Pearland to Sugarland, Miss City, Galveston, etc. We finally got to Jeff’s and the first thing I thought when I walked in was how clean it was while looking like your typically NYC bagel shop. These bagels are phenomenal. And I travel the world for bagels! They are boiled, heavily seasoned, and cooked to perfection which everyone knows is a little crunch on the outside and fluff on the inside. Tried the rosemary salt (in my top 3 of all time), Asiago, funnel cake, cacio e Pepe. All were absolutely delicious, although I’m not typically a sweet bagel person. We tried the original, veggie and cannoli shmear. The vegetable cream cheese stuck out because it had full pieces of veggie in it so it really takes on the great flavors. Cannoli was obviously delicious and has mini chocolate chips in it. I could honestly just eat it with a spoon. Coffees both hot and iced were top notch. Usually bagel places don’t specialize in drinks as well but Jeff’s really does it all!
